Coca-Cola (NYSE: KO) has been crushing the overall market in 2026. As of Sept. 3, shares have climbed 26%. This performance is, surprisingly, ahead of all the "Magnificent Seven" stocks.
But the beverage stock's impressive gains isn't why it's in portfolios. Instead, it's because the business is highly regarded among passive income investors. The track record speaks for itself.
